双栈法的两个典型例子

书中双栈法的两个典型例子

基本步骤:创建运算符栈和操作数栈,遇到操作数和运算符分别入栈,忽略 “(”,遇到 “)”则弹出运算符和操作数进行运算,得到结果推入运算数栈

  • 表达式求值

import java.util.Scanner;
import java.util.Stack;

public class Expr {
    
    
	//简单起见,输入不省略任何符号
	public static void main(String[] args) {
    
    
		Scanner input = new Scanner(System.in);
		String s = input.next();
		Stack<Character> op = new Stack<>();
		Stack<Double> num = new Stack<>();
		for(int i = 0; i < s.length(); i++) {
    
    
			char ch = s.charAt(i);
			if(ch >= '0' && ch <= '9')
				num.push(Double.parseDouble(ch + ""));
			else if(ch == '+' || ch == '-' || ch == '*' || ch == '/')
				op.push(ch);
			else if(ch == ')') {
    
    
				double op2 = num.pop();
				double op1 = num.pop();
				char opr = op.pop();
				double result = 0;
				switch(opr) {
    
    
				case '+': result = op1 + op2;break;
				case '-': result = op1 - op2;break;
				case '*': result = op1 * op2;break;
				case '/': result = op1 / op2;break;
				}
				num.push(result);
			}
		}
		while(!op.empty()) {
    
    
			double op2 = num.pop();
			double op1 = num.pop();
			char opr = op.pop();
			double result = 0;
			switch(opr) {
    
    
			case '+': result = op1 + op2;break;
			case '-': result = op1 - op2;break;
			case '*': result = op1 * op2;break;
			case '/': result = op1 / op2;break;
			}
			num.push(result);
		}
		System.out.println(num.pop());
	}
}

  • 补齐左括号

import java.util.Scanner;
import java.util.Stack;
//1+2)*3-4)*5-6)))
public class Fix {
    
    
	public static void main(String[] args) {
    
    
		Scanner input = new Scanner(System.in);
		String s = input.next();
		Stack<String> op = new Stack<>();
		Stack<String> expr = new Stack<>();
		for(int i = 0; i < s.length(); i++) {
    
    
			char ch = s.charAt(i);
			if(ch >= '0' && ch <= '9')
				expr.push(ch + "");
			else if(ch != ')')
				op.push(ch + "");
			else {
    
    
				String opchar = op.pop();
				String op2 = expr.pop();
				String op1 = expr.pop();
				String temp = "(" + op1 + opchar + op2 + ")";
				expr.push(temp);
			}
		}
		while(!op.empty()) {
    
    
			String opchar = op.pop();
			String op2 = expr.pop();
			String op1 = expr.pop();
			String temp = "(" + op1 + opchar + op2 + ")";
			expr.push(temp);
		}
		while(!expr.empty())
			System.out.println(expr.pop());
	}
}
